 Understanding the Essence of Dissection Kits

Dissection kits serve as indispensable resources for students and educators alike, offering a tangible platform to explore the complexities of human anatomy. These kits typically comprise a variety of tools essential for anatomical exploration, including scalpels, forceps, scissors, and dissecting needles. More importantly, they provide anatomical specimens for hands-on learning experiences, fostering a deeper understanding of anatomical structures and their interrelationships.

 Enhancing Student Engagement and Retention

Engagement is key to effective learning, and dissection kits excel in capturing the interest and attention of students. By actively participating in dissection exercises, students are more likely to remain engaged and retain information effectively. The hands-on nature of dissection fosters a sense of curiosity and exploration, encouraging students to delve deeper into the subject matter. Moreover, research suggests that active learning methods, such as dissection, result in higher levels of knowledge retention compared to passive learning approaches.


 Fostering Critical Thinking and Problem-Solving Skills

Anatomy education goes beyond memorization; it cultivates critical thinking and problem-solving skills essential for future healthcare professionals. Dissection encourages students to think analytically as they navigate through anatomical structures, identify organs, and understand their functions. Moreover, encountering variations in anatomical structures during dissection prompts students to adapt and problem-solve—a skill vital in clinical practice.
